What is a foreman?

Foremen are supervisory personnel in construction and other labor-intensive industries who oversee and coordinate the work of crews on job sites. They are responsible for managing day-to-day operations, ensuring safety standards are met, and communicating between workers and higher management. Foremen also monitor progress, resolve issues as they arise, and ensure that projects are completed on time and within budget. Their leadership and technical knowledge are crucial for the smooth and efficient completion of projects.

What does a foreman do?

A foreman typically works to oversee operations on a construction site, although they may also manage operations in the shipping and warehousing industries. The job duties of a foreman are to hire, train, and schedule workers for a construction project. They assign tasks to workers, ensure quality and safety, schedule additional laborers as needed, and ensure completion of the project on schedule. The qualifications that you need to become a foreman include experience working in construction (or in some cases at a warehouse or factory) and knowledge of safety regulations. Some roles may require specialized training or certification.

How does a foreman typically manage communication and coordination between different trades on a construction site?

A Foreman plays a crucial role in facilitating clear communication and coordination among various trades, such as electricians, plumbers, and carpenters, on a construction site. This often involves conducting daily briefings, maintaining up-to-date schedules, and addressing any conflicts or changes in project plans. By ensuring everyone is aligned on tasks and timelines, the Foreman helps prevent delays and maintains a safe, efficient work environment. Strong interpersonal skills and the ability to quickly resolve issues are key to success in this aspect of the role.

What is the difference between Foreman vs Supervisor?

AspectForemanSupervisor
CredentialsTypically requires relevant trade certifications or experienceOften requires supervisory or management training, sometimes a degree
Work EnvironmentHands-on, on-site leadership of construction or industrial teamsOversees teams, manages schedules, and enforces policies, often in office or site settings
Industry UsageCommon in construction, manufacturing, and industrial sectorsUsed across various industries including construction, manufacturing, and service sectors

While both roles involve team oversight, a Foreman primarily leads on-site work and technical tasks, whereas a Supervisor manages broader team operations and administrative duties. The Foreman is more hands-on with daily tasks, while the Supervisor focuses on planning, coordination, and higher-level management.
